In a captivating ceremony at the GFA conference room, the Ghana Football Association introduced Lele Tasty Foods and Company Limited as its official Meal Partner.

Lele Tasty Foods will provide the Ghana Football Association with some food products which include Lele Rice, Lele corned Beef, Lele Baked beans, Lele Sunflower Oil, Lele Instant Noodles, Lele Milk, Lele Cornflakes, Lele teabags, Lele Spaghetti frozen chicken, frozen beef, turkey wings, Lele sardines, Lele Soya sauce and much more.

At the unveiling, President of the Ghana Football Association, Kurt.E.S Okraku, expressed gratitude to Lele Foods Ghana for their confidence and trust in the GFA.

“It is our first partnership of the year 2024 and indeed it comes at a time that the Ghana Football Association has announced the establishment of more national teams taking our tally of national teams to 20,” he said.
“We are indeed very grateful to LeLe Tasty Foods Ghana Limited for showing so much faith and confidence in the leadership of our dear Ghana Football Association and in our intention to vindicate this confidence in the most meaningful way.

Group Chief Executive of Lele, Hussein Jaber, also assured that the Sponsorship deal will not only aim at developing Ghana Football but will also seek to empower Ghanaian Athletes and fans.

“At Lele, we believe in the power of sports to unite communities, inspire individuals and drive positive change. Together with the Ghana Football Association, we aim to, not only support the development of football in Ghana, but also to empower athletes, inspire fans and elevate the beautiful game to new heights”.

I want to express my gratitude to the Ghana Football Association for the opportunity provided for the collaboration between the Lele brand and the GFA.”

Lele’s recent announcement of a three-year sponsorship agreement adds to an impressive roster of sponsors for the GFA, joining the ranks of StarTimes, Malta Guinness, Nasco, Tecno, and others
